Consider a bob of mass 0.2 kg is performing linear SHM experiences a restoring force of 2 N when its displacement is 10 cm. Find the period of SHM.
A. 1.34 s
B. 0.314 s
C. 0.942 s
D. 0.628 s

Correct Answer - D
Given, mass m = 0.2 kg
force, F = 2 N
displacement, x = 10 cm = 0.1 m
We know that restoring force, F = -kx
`therefore" "k = (F)/(x)=(2)/(0.1)=20Nm^(-1)`
The period of SHM, `T = 2pi sqrt((m)/(k))`
`= 2 xx 3.14 xx sqrt((0.2)/(20))`
`rArr" "T = 0.628 s`
